Frequently asked questions

What are the months with the coldest sea water in Pulupandan?

The months with the coldest seawater in Pulupandan, Philippines, are January and February, with an average sea temperature of 26.9°C (80.4°F).

What month is the sea warmest in Pulupandan?

The month with the warmest seawater in Pulupandan is June, with an average sea temperature of 29.9°C (85.8°F).

When are the longest days in Pulupandan?

With an average of 12h and 42min of daylight, June has the longest days of the year in Pulupandan, Philippines.

What is the month with the shortest days in Pulupandan?

December has the shortest days of the year, with an average of 11h and 30min of daylight.

Is there Daylight Saving Time (DST) in Pulupandan?

Pulupandan does not utilize Daylight Saving Time (DST). PST timezone is used throughout the entire year.
